Two sites, more than 1,400 youth, leaders, and
storytellers. Worship, classes, small groups. Laughing,
singing, meeting God…priceless.
The two International Youth Forum (IYF) sites are well into planning to
teach new generations about the ethics of Christ’s peace in all arenas of
life. The IYF foundations will include ministry that focuses on Doctrine and
Covenants 163 and the sermon on the mount.
Sites outside the United States will explore selected scriptures and cultural emersions that examine what it means to be a world citizen.
The Independence, Missouri, IYF will feature six worships, enhanced by musician Ken Medema, that engage youth in the theme, “One.” Other themes will build on “One”:
One God, One Christ, One Spirit
One Person
One People, One Planet
One Peace
One Vision, One Mission
Classes, which will help blend communal learning into the worships, will include:
Many Stories—One Story
One Big Game
One Peace
Many People—One Planet
Many Needs—One Mission
Also, small groups will include a session with an apostle. These groups will give youth the chance to meet others, discuss key issues in their Christian walk, and explore topics that relate to Community of Christ’s mission.
The Village, back by popular demand, again will take place at multiple sites throughout the Temple complex.
Finally, youth will receive several informal opportunities to mingle with others. These will include a Tuesday-night street party, a Wednesday-night activity sponsored by Outreach International, and a Thursday-evening concert by Medema. Following the concert, participants will enjoy ice cream on the World Plaza.
